A Solid Thanksgiving Compared to Historical Weather

While it’s all clear skies today, Newberry’s past Thanksgivings have been a rollercoaster when it comes to weather! For instance, who could forget last Thanksgiving on November 27, 2022? Newberry experienced a whopping 3.0 inches of snowfall, making it one of the heaviest snowfalls recorded on this holiday in South Carolina. In stark contrast, on this day back in 1931, Newberry reveled in its warmest November 27, reaching a delightful high of 50.2°F (10.1°C). So, let’s be thankful for this cooler, clear day!

Looking to the Future

November overall tends to be uneventful in terms of weather, with an average high temperature of 66.6°F (19.2°C) and an average low of 41.2°F (5.1°C). In fact, we often see about 3.2 inches (80.3 mm) of rain during the month. However, November can surprise us with a considerable range in temperatures and weather events, as past records suggest.

It’s not just temperature that varies – precipitation has seen highs as much as 10.08 inches (256.9 mm) in 1985, showcasing how unpredictable our November weather can be! And for snow enthusiasts, let’s not forget those epic days like November 27, 1932, with a stunning 11.2 inches (28.4 cm) blanketing the ground.
